Raya commended Rice for his impressive performances, even calling him one of the top midfielders in the world. "He can do everything from defensive to attacking roles, and he's also skilled at taking free kicks," Raya said. "He's improved this season compared to last year, and he's still young, but he's clearly become a top player and a leader."
Arsenal won 2-0 against PSG in the Champions League group stage, but Raya's team is not taking their upcoming match lightly. PSG has shown significant improvement since their last meeting, having knocked out Liverpool and Aston Villa in the previous rounds. Raya watched their match against Villa and was impressed by their teamwork and consistency.
"Their match against Villa was intense, and even when we played them earlier this season, they looked like a different team," Raya said. "They press well together and maintain their intensity throughout the game."
